A Wide Ranging Effort

Natasha Korecki says her Politico story shows a wide ranging effort aimed at Kamala Harris, Beto O’Rourke, Elizabeth Warren and Bernie Sanders. She reports certainly it is up and running with signs foreign state actors are behind some of it.

It’s Happening Again

According to Politico Weaponized Propaganda picks at the most sensitive issues in our public discourse. Furthermore that propaganda is being pushed across a variety of platforms. It’s happening again.

Wait! Not All Of It Is Organized!

Wait though. Not all the activity is organized. In contrast, a lot of it appears to be regular Joe’s sharing stuff they think is funny or relevant on their feeds.

Sources For Politico Article Include Democrat Operatives

Finally sources for this story include Brett Horvath who has worked for the Mayor of Seattle as well as other operatives who have worked for democrats including Hillary Clinton. Or companies like Storyful who spy on reporters.

No Conclusive Evidence

Even more Korecki writes researchers and others cannot conclusively point to actors behind “the coordinated activity”.
